We made a quick visit to this recently closed hospital/home/school for special needs patients. Demolition has started on the less interesting of the buildings onsite, but the older admin block which has some unique features is being retained. The school round at the back of the site is very securely boarded, and even behind the boards the doors are all locked.

The place was on the whole unremarkable - nearly everything had been removed from the site, and the services building has already been stripped and demolished - but there is little to no vandalism, which is a rare sight.
